PROGRAM GUIDE WITH SPOILER PREVENTION

    Abstract: Systems and methods related to improved program guide are provided. In one example, a method includes: receiving a first user request for browsing a program guide for digital programs on a client device, transmitting data corresponding to the program guide to the client device, and displaying the program guide in a user interface. The program guide includes multiple program preview boards, and each program preview board corresponds to a digital program or a recorded digital program and includes information related to the digital program or the recorded digital program. The method further includes providing a first selectable option for the user to enable or disable a first spoiler prevention feature and enabling or disabling the first spoiler prevention feature based on the user's selection. The first spoiler prevention feature is configured to hide a part of the information related to the digital program in the corresponding program preview.

    MULTIMODAL TRANSFER BETWEEN AUDIO AND VIDEO STREAMS

    Abstract: The present disclosure is directed to systems and methods for multimodal transition among devices connected to a plurality of different networks. A device may be presenting a multimedia item in a first mode (e.g., an audiovisual mode) on a first device. A transition event may occur, prompting the systems and methods described herein to initiate a transition request to transition the multimedia item from a first device to a second device. The second device may be analyzed to determine the constraints of the device (e.g., storage, hardware/software, connectivity strength, etc.). The first mode of the multimedia item may also be analyzed. Based on the analysis of the multimedia item in the first mode and the second device, the multimedia item may be converted from a first mode to a second mode (e.g., an audio-only mode of the multimedia item) and subsequently displayed on the second device.

    CORRECTING AD MARKERS IN MEDIA CONTENT

    Abstract: Content is received from a content origin and includes a first I frame occurring in the content at an actual start time of an ad segment. The content includes an ad marker comprising an indicated start time of an available segment, and the actual start time is within a predetermined period of the indicated start time. The ad marker is updated to set the indicated start time equal to the actual start time. The predetermined period may be within 0.5 seconds of the indicated start time. A second I frame may be detected in the content, and a signature may be generated for content at the time of the first I frame. The first I frame corresponds to the actual start time in response to the first I frame occurring before the second I frame and in response to the signature matching a signature of a known ad.

    MEDIA SIGNATURE RECOGNITION WITH RESOURCE CONSTRAINED DEVICES

    Abstract: The present invention recognizes media content using signatures generated by network devices with limited processing power. An audio signal is prepared for application of a discrete Fourier transform (DFT). Outputs from the DFT include real components and imaginary components that are used to calculate output magnitudes associated with frequency bins. The frequency-amplitude pairs include the output magnitudes and the associated frequency bins. A signature of the audio signal is generated by selecting a predetermined number of frequency-amplitude pairs having dominant output magnitudes. The network devices that generate the signatures may transmit the signatures to a server for analysis. The server may trigger actions in response to detecting known content based on the received signatures matching known signatures.

    Systems and methods for optimal over-the-air antenna installation

    Abstract: Examples of the present disclosure describe systems and methods for locating an optimal installation location for an over-the-air (OTA) antenna. In some example aspects, the system described herein may receive a list of preferred local channels and/or programs from a user. The system may then compare those channels and/or programs to at least one database that comprises channel frequencies based on a user's geolocation (e.g., GPS coordinates, address, zip code, etc.). Based on the comparison of the preferred channels and/or programs, the system may suggest a certain installation location of an OTA antenna. The system may evaluate broadcast signals received by the OTA antenna to determine the strength of the signals at the present OTA antenna location. The results of the channel feedback analysis may be displayed in real-time (or near real-time) on a mobile device, indicating to the user if the present location is an optimal installation location.

    APPARATUSES, SYSTEMS, AND METHODS FOR ADDING FUNCTIONALITIES TO A CIRCULAR BUTTON ON A REMOTE CONTROL DEVICE

    Abstract: Apparatuses, Methods, and Systems to enable the display of media content, the apparatus includes a remote control device; a keypad with a plurality of buttons for controlling a media player device; a circular button of the plurality of buttons that is configured to rotate in a clockwise direction and a counterclockwise direction; and in response to detected rotational motion either in the clockwise direction or the counterclockwise direction, the media player device is configured to cause an adjustable amount of forwarding or a reverse play operation in a position of playing streamed media content on a display device; wherein the adjustable amount of forwarding or reverse play operation of streamed media content corresponds to rotational motion detected of the circular button during the playing of the streamed media content.

    SYSTEMS AND METHODS FOR AUTOMATED EVALUATION OF DIGITAL SERVICES

    Abstract: A digital service evaluation system evaluates services and user sessions provided by a service, to provide an overall score of the service. The digital service evaluation system detects client sessions associated with one or more devices. The digital service evaluation system obtains a first plurality of scores associated with performance metrics of the client session, and calculates an overall score for the client session. The digital service evaluation system obtains a second plurality of scores and calculates a second overall score. The digital service evaluation system determines a weight for each performance metric based on the first and second plurality of scores and the overall scores. The digital service evaluation system uses the weights to determine which performance metric caused a change in the overall scores. The digital service evaluation system takes an action based on the determination that a performance metric caused a change in the overall scores.
